Shoreham is a locality in the Mornington Peninsula Shire local government area of Victoria, Australia. It is a small community with a population of 573. The locality covers an area of 20.2 km², giving a population density of about 28.4 people per km². It sits at an elevation of around 60 m above sea level. It lies approximately 68 km south of Melbourne. Shoreham is located at 38.4270°S, 145.0372°E. It observes Australian Eastern Time (AEST/AEDT). Postcode: 3916. The Australian Bureau of Statistics classifies the area as Inner Regional Australia.

It lies 22.3 km south of Mornington, VIC (from Mornington, VIC: bearing 185°T), and is situated 12.3 km east-south-east of Rosebud.
